What is Managed WordPress Hosting?

Managed WordPress hosting is a type of web hosting service that is specifically designed to run WordPress websites. It includes a variety of features and support that are tailored to the needs of WordPress users, such as:

  • Automatic WordPress updates
  • Enhanced security features
  • WordPress-optimized performance
  • Expert WordPress support
  • Less control over the server environment

WordPress hosting typically uses a shared hosting platform, but with additional features and optimizations for WordPress. These factors are caching, security plugins, and optimized database settings. Plus, it’s typically more expensive than shared hosting, but it can be a good option for businesses and individuals who rely on their WordPress website for their business or livelihood.

Check below the Advantages of Managed WordPress Hosting.

  • Peace of mind: Managed WordPress hosting providers take care of all the technical aspects of running a WordPress site, including security, updates, and performance. This allows you to focus on your content and business.
  • Improved performance: Managed WordPress hosting providers typically use specialized servers and software that are optimized for WordPress performance. This will increase the speed and ensure the smooth working of the website.   
  • Enhanced security: Managed WordPress hosting providers typically include a variety of security features to protect your website from hackers and malware. This includes things like firewalls, malware scanning, and intrusion detection systems.
  • Expert support: Managed WordPress hosting providers typically offer expert WordPress support. This means you can get help from people who know WordPress inside and out if you have any problems with your website.

Additional Features:

  • In the WordPress hosting plan, you’ll receive the WP Toolkit, a powerful set of tools to enhance your WordPress website’s performance and management capabilities.
  • Automatic backups are a standard feature that allows easy recovery in case of data loss or website issues. This will help in optimizing and managing plugins to ensure it doesn’t impact the website’s performance.
  • In Managed WordPress hosting, you also get protection against Distributed Denial of Service attacks just to ensure website availability. 

If you’re serious about your WordPress website, then managed WordPress hosting is a good option to consider. It can provide you with the peace of mind, performance, security, and support that you need to succeed.

What is VPS Hosting?

VPS hosting, or virtual private server hosting, is a type of web hosting that uses virtualization technology to create multiple virtual servers on a single physical server. Every virtual server has its own allocated resources like CPU, RAM, and Disk Space. This gives VPS hosting users more control and flexibility than shared hosting, but less than dedicated hosting.

VPS hosting is a good option for businesses and individuals who need more control over their web hosting environment than shared hosting can offer, but don’t need the full resources of a dedicated server. VPS hosting is also a good option for websites that are experiencing high traffic or that require specific software or configurations.

Check below the advantages of Managed WordPress Hosting:

  • More control and flexibility: VPS hosting gives more control and flexibility over your web hosting environment than shared hosting. You can choose your own operating system, install your own software, and configure your server to your specific needs.
  • Dedicated resources: Each VPS has its own dedicated resources, such as CPU, RAM, and disk space. This indicates that your website is safe and doesn’t affect other websites’ performance on the same server.
  • Scalability: VPS hosting is scalable, so you can easily add more resources to your server as your needs grow.
  • Affordability: VPS hosting is more affordable than dedicated hosting, but more expensive than shared hosting.

Overall, VPS hosting is a good option for businesses and individuals who need more control and flexibility over their web hosting environment than shared hosting can offer, but don’t need the full resources of a dedicated server.

Here are some examples of when VPS hosting might be a good choice:

  • You have a website that is experiencing high traffic.
  • You need to run specific software or configurations that are not available on shared hosting.
  • You get root access to your server.
  • You need to be able to isolate your website from other websites on the same server.
  • You need to be able to scale your server resources up or down as needed.

Managed WordPress Hosting v/s VPS Hosting

Whether you should choose managed WordPress hosting or VPS hosting depends on your specific needs and requirements.

Easy to Use

Managed WordPress Hosting: Managed WordPress hosting is generally easier to use than VPS hosting, because the web hosting provider takes care of all the technical aspects of running a WordPress site.

VPS Hosting: VPS hosting is more difficult to use than managed WordPress hosting because it requires more technical knowledge to manage.

Control

Managed WordPress Hosting: Managed WordPress hosting gives you less control over your server environment than VPS hosting.

VPS: VPS hosting gives you more control over your server environment than managed WordPress hosting. You can install and configure any software you want, and configure your server to your specific needs.

Performance

Managed WordPress Hosting: Managed WordPress hosting providers typically use specialized servers and software that are optimized for WordPress performance.

VPS: VPS hosting performance can vary depending on the configuration of your server and the software you install. However, VPS hosting can generally offer better performance than shared hosting, especially for high-traffic websites.

Security

Managed WordPress Hosting: Managed WordPress hosting providers typically include a variety of security features to protect your website from hackers and malware.

VPS: VPS hosting security is your responsibility, so you need to make sure to install and configure security software and keep it up to date. However, VPS hosting can generally offer better security than shared hosting, because your website is isolated from other websites on the same server.

Support

Managed WordPress Hosting: Managed WordPress hosting providers typically offer expert WordPress support. 

VPS: VPS hosting providers may offer general server support, but they may not be able to provide expert support for WordPress.

Price

Managed WordPress Hosting: Managed WordPress hosting is typically more expensive than VPS hosting.

VPS: VPS hosting is typically more expensive than shared hosting, but less expensive than dedicated hosting.

Which one is right for you?

If you are a beginner or you don’t have the time or technical expertise to manage your own WordPress site, then managed WordPress hosting is a good option. Managed WordPress hosting providers take care of all the technical aspects of running a WordPress site, so you can focus on your content and business.

If you need more control over your server environment or you need to run specific software or configurations that are not available on managed WordPress hosting, then VPS hosting is a good option. VPS hosting is also a good option for high-traffic websites and websites that require specific security or performance requirements.

Ultimately, the best way to decide which type of hosting is right for you is to consider your specific needs and requirements.
